The Shutout Spartans Win Their 15th State Championship Without Yielding A Point In The Playoffs

Auburndale Fl– The St. Johns Country Day girls’ soccer team left no doubt who was the best in Class 1A this season. With a dominant 4-0 win over Pine in the state championship game, the Spartans claimed their 15th state title, finishing off an incredible playoff run. St. Johns Bartram Trail shocks St. Thomas Aquinas to win FHSAA 6A title

Bartram Trail senior Ali Fletcher headed a corner kick home with 19 seconds remaining in double overtime to lift the Bears to a fourth title in six years. Bartram won 4-3 over 15-time state champion St. Thomas AquinasClick Here: Read More From https://www.officialfloridafc.com/
